One effect of the visit of the Epidemic Commission to v the quarantine station at Somes Island, says a Press Association message, is to draw attention to the total inadequacy of the buildings for the purpose. They are 40 years old, worm-eaten and deficient in every convenience, and cannot accommodate any large number. It is estimated that a heavy sum will be required to install the buildings with appliances suitable for accommodating a large number of persons. An accident, happily without any serious results, occurred at the Rangiora railway station at about 4.45 p.m. ou Saturday. The Christchurch-Waikari train was standing at the platform, and some carriages were being taken up the line to enable them to be shunted on to a siding, when by some means they got out of control and rau back ou to the standing train. They had a fair way on, and the force with wliich they struck the train forced it back about half a chain. The worst experience the passengers had was a considerable shock. One of the empty carriages was derailed, blocking traffic for. some time. The carriages hit end on received considerable damage to their buffers and other iron work.
